The Graduate Aid Program Manager is a new position within the Office of Student Financial Services (OSFS) created to support the growing graduate student population and an increase in the number of Graduate Academic programs. S/he supports students, academic departments, and university staff by providing comprehensive graduate aid support all the way from counseling prospective students to system work in Banner for need-based financial aid and merit awards alike. The incumbent plays a key role in all daily aspects of administering graduate financial aid, being the first point of contact for both prospective and current graduate students who are seeking financial aid advising and financial support and providing both client services and financial aid counseling. Under the general direction of the Associate Dean, the Graduate Aid Program Manager has additional duties that include but are not limited to:
  • Sets up academic enrollment periods in the Banner student system and assists in updating and maintaining the financial aid yearly setup for Main Campus graduate programs that entails setting up aid periods for current and new programs.
  • Builds budget component rules and assists in establishing graduate cost of attendance budgets, maintaining and updating these budgets for each academic program.
  • Applies appropriate budget rules In the Banner student system to account for the many different aid disbursement scenarios associated with each graduate program.
  • Working closely with other OSFS staff, creates graduate ad-hoc operational reports using our current reporting applications, Cognos, and population selection (Popsel) queries in Banner.
  • Processes daily system jobs that support this operation to effectively deliver financial aid in the form of both scholarships and loans on a timely basis.
  • Automates and schedules batch production processing for systems jobs that can be automated, maintaining and posting graduate school financial aid information on the OSFS website.
  • Maintains professional and technical knowledge by attending educational workshops and training, reviewing operational professional publications, and establishing personal/professional networks.
  • Works closely with the graduate academic departments to secure their merit awards on a timely basis so the need-based part of their aid application can be processed.
  • Serves as the point of main contact for graduate student financial aid inquiries, answering general questions posed by prospective graduate aid applicants and current graduate students' aid.
  • Helps manage the "suspense" file in Banner when graduate students' applications do not get into Banner appropriately, resolving the problem and loading suspense records into Banner.
  • Reviews graduate aid applications and processes awards for merit aid, federal loans, and private loans.
  • Discusses financial aid awards with prospective and current students, providing debt management counseling and explaining how aid is disbursed to cover direct and indirect costs incurred by the graduate student.
  • Performs the Federal verification recess as needed.
